"'Phlebopus marginatus'', known as the salmon gum mushroom in Western Australia, is a member of the Boletales or pored fungi and possibly Australia's largest terrestrial mushroom with the weight of one specimen from Victoria recorded at 29 kg . It is an imposing sight in forests of southeastern and southwestern Australia.
